Full Description
This exam emphasizes the fundamental properties of clay and its transformation through various firing techniques to create pottery. It investigates the scientific principles influencing clay's workability, plasticity, and final form.
Understanding clay composition and behavior is crucial for achieving desired qualities in ceramic products. The implications of material selection on the durability and aesthetic value of pottery items reflect a significant influence on both artistic and commercial aspects within the craft.
The exam will assess students' capacity to articulate their knowledge regarding clay types, firing temperatures, and the effects of additives on finished products. Students should be prepared to discuss these themes verbally with clarity and precision.
A thorough grasp of the theoretical principles outlined will facilitate a deeper appreciation for the materials used in pottery, ultimately enhancing students' profiles as informed creators in the field.
